3:30 p.m. April 13 — A Slippery Rock University student was arrested after she allegedly shoved and elbowed a police officer trying to arrest her during an incident at a student apartment complex.

The incident began with an apparent disagreement between roommates, according to court documents. Police went to the apartment and found two students, including Essence L. Cooper, 19, of Uniontown, Fayette County, who refused to provide an officer with her identification, according to court documents.

The officer moved in to arrest Cooper, police said, and she “yanked her arm away” as police tried to place her in handcuffs; she eventually “shoved” and “elbowed” the officer, documents said.

Police subsequently handcuffed Cooper and took her to the station. After consulting with an assistant district attorney, police charged her with resisting arrest, simple assault and disorderly conduct.

District Judge Sue Haggerty arraigned Cooper on the charges. She was placed in the Butler County Prison on $5,000 bail following arraignment.
